The UK government Department for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y (BEIS) has provided £32.9 million (US$39.67 million) to five energy storage projects to support the development of new technologies such as thermal batteries and liquid flow batteries. The consultation is part of BEIS'' policy development for energy storage that has been ongoing since November 2016. This has already led to energy storage facilities being confirmed as a form of generating station, and thereby rendering them capable of being NSIP if greater than 50MW capacity. TORONTO, CANADA & LONDON, UK – February 22, 2022 – A consortium of EDF, io consulting, and Hydrostor Inc. has won £1 million from the UK Government department for Business, Energy & Industrial Strategy (BEIS) to develop storage of electricity as compressed air.
